Everything You Need to Know About Floor Prep: The Foundation of a Perfect Flooring

When it comes to flooring installations, most people focus on the type of flooring material, color, and design. However, an often overlooked but critical aspect of any successful flooring project is floor preparation. At Precision Floor Coverings LLC, we believe that understanding and implementing proper floor prep is pivotal in achieving a flawless finish that lasts. In this blog, we explore everything you need to know about floor prep to ensure your flooring project becomes the masterpiece you envision.

**The Importance of Floor Prep**

Before laying down any flooring, ensuring the subfloor is well-prepared sets the foundation for the longevity and performance of the flooring. Floor preparation is essential for preventing issues such as uneven surfaces, cracking, and premature wear. It involves cleaning, leveling, and ensuring the surface is smooth and dry before installation. Without these steps, you could face costly repairs or replacements.

**Steps in Floor Preparation**

1. **Assessment and Cleaning**

The first step in floor prep is assessing the existing condition of your subfloor. At Precision Floor Coverings LLC, our professionals conduct a detailed inspection to identify any damages such as cracks or moisture issues. After a thorough examination, cleaning the subfloor is crucial to remove all dirt, debris, and residue, which can interfere with adhesives and flooring materials.

2. **Moisture and Repairs**

Moisture is a flooring nemesis, particularly for hardwood and laminate applications. We measure moisture levels to confirm the subfloor is dry. If any moisture issues are detected, they must be resolved before proceeding. Additionally, necessary repairs like filling cracks or securing loose boards are completed to ensure a solid and secure foundation.

3. **Leveling the Subfloor**

An uneven subfloor can lead to significant problems, such as gaps or premature wear. Self-leveling compounds or patches are commonly used to create a smooth surface. It's imperative to address even minor dips or high points to prevent issues down the line. Our experts ensure that your flooring is installed on a perfectly leveled foundation, contributing to a uniform and stable end result.

4. **Underlayment Installation**

The underlayment acts as a buffer between the subfloor and the flooring material, offering sound absorption and thermal insulation. Depending on the type of flooring chosen, different underlayments may be required. By selecting the correct underlayment, we optimize the performance and comfort of your new floors, ensuring they last for years to come.
